The Hormonal Connection to Hair Loss

Understanding the root causes of hair loss can empower individuals to make informed decisions about treatment. Many people are unaware that hormonal imbalances can contribute significantly to conditions like alopecia. Factors such as aging, stress, and lifestyle choices can disrupt hormone levels, impacting scalp health and hair growth. For those keen on addressing hair loss, gaining insights into hormonal health becomes paramount.

Exploring Effective Hair Loss Treatments With advancements in science, a variety of hair restoration methods have gained popularity. Techniques like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) and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) therapy have emerged as effective medical solutions to combat hair loss. FUE involves extracting individual hair follicles and transplanting them to thinning areas, while PRP therapy uses a patient’s own platelets to promote scalp health and stimulate hair growth. Laser Hair Therapy: A Modern Approach Another interesting method is laser hair therapy, which employs low-level lasers to stimulate hair follicles and improve circulation in the scalp. This non-invasive procedure has shown promising results for those struggling with hair loss, often touted for its minimal side effects compared to surgical interventions.
